Crypto Trading Signals

Signal

Crypto trading signals represent discrete, actionable recommendations generated through quantitative analysis or qualitative assessments, intended to inform trading decisions within cryptocurrency markets, options, and related derivatives. These signals typically specify an asset, direction (buy or sell), and a potential price target or stop-loss level, often accompanied by a rationale based on technical indicators, on-chain metrics, or macroeconomic factors. The efficacy of a signal hinges on the robustness of its underlying methodology and its ability to adapt to evolving market dynamics, particularly within the volatile crypto ecosystem where rapid price movements and regulatory shifts are commonplace. Sophisticated traders often integrate signals into broader risk management frameworks, employing them as one component of a diversified strategy rather than relying solely on their recommendations.
